Cohiba was established in 1966 as A non-public brand for Fidel Castro and significant-ranking Cuban officers. For many years, these cigars were being exclusively reserved for diplomatic items and state features, never available to the general public. The brand grew to become commercially available in 1982 and speedily rose to be essentially the most regarded title in Cuban cigars.
